Navigating the EB-1B Visa: A Guide for Outstanding Professors and Researchers

What is an EB-1B visa?

 

EB-1B visa is a category of employment-based immigrant visa for foreign nationals who are outstanding researchers or professors. It is one of the employment-based preference categories in the United States immigration system, specifically designed for individuals with exceptional research or teaching abilities.

Here are some key characteristics of the EB-1B visa:

  • Eligibility Criteria: To qualify for an EB-1B visa, you must meet specific criteria, including:
    • You must have a permanent job offer from a U.S. employer.
    • You must be recognized as an outstanding researcher or professor in your academic field.
    • You must have at least three years of research or teaching experience.
    • You must be coming to the United States to pursue tenure or a comparable position at a university or other academic institution.

In around 2,000 BCE, the Minoans on the Greek island of Crete built a 50 km road leading from the palace of Gortyn on the south side of the island, through the mountains, to the palace of Knossos on the north side of the island. Tools were initially developed by hominids through observation and trial and error. Around 2 Mya , they learned to make the first stone tools by hammering flakes off a pebble, forming a sharp hand axe. This practice was refined 75 kya into pressure flaking, enabling much finer work. In 2005, futurist Ray Kurzweil claimed the next technological revolution would rest upon advances in genetics, nanotechnology, and robotics, with robotics being the most impactful of the three. Genetic engineering will allow far greater control over human biological nature through a process called directed evolution. Some thinkers believe that this may shatter our sense of self, and have urged for renewed public debate exploring the issue more thoroughly; others fear that directed evolution could lead to eugenics or extreme social inequality. Nanotechnology will grant us the ability to manipulate matter “at the molecular and atomic scale”, which could allow us to reshape ourselves and our environment in fundamental ways.
